8 Can Taco Soup

One of the EASIEST recipes I have done in a long time. Another delicious supper option, especially on these cold winter days. Soup is always a good options on those days. 

All you need is:

  • 1 can chicken broth
  • 1 can cream of chicken
  • 1 can chicken - drained
  • 1 can pinto beans - drained and rinsed
  • 1 can black beans - drained and rinsed
  • 1 can corn - drained
  • 1 can diced tomatoes - drained
  • 1 can enchilada sauce
  • 1 packet taco seasoning
For picky eaters you can add and take away pretty much anything you would like to make it your own. I would have used smaller diced tomatoes because I don't really like large chunks in mine.

Dump all the cans and taco seasoning into a crock pot and cook on low for 2-3 hours. If you are in more of a hurry you can cook on stovetop as well. 

Serve with sour cream, shredded cheese, and Fritos instead of crackers.
